HeartCode® BLS Online for International is a self-directed, comprehensive eLearning program that uses adaptive learning technology to allow learners to acquire and demonstrate Basic Life Support (BLS) skills using a personalised learning path that adapts in real time to a learner’s performance. Students who successfully complete the eLearning cognitive portion and the hands-on session (skills) will receive an AHA BLS Provider course completion card (eCard), valid for two years.

Access to the BLS Provider Manual eBook (International English) (25-2802) is included with HeartCode BLS. You will be able to access the Provider Manual from within the course.
The program is designed for healthcare professionals who need Basic Life Support training for their clinical duties. Utilising a variety of eLearning assets such as dramatisations, Cognitive Assessment Activities (CAAs), illustrations, knowledge checks and interactive activities, this program teaches BLS knowledge and skills. This method of learning provides training consistency and adaptability to different learning styles. Students can work at their own pace, applying their knowledge to real-time decision-making. Debriefings and coaching are provided immediately after each knowledge check and each Cognitive Assessment Activity.
